688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

节点

小议基于嵌入式Linux操作系统的AODV路由协议

2023-12-29 03:49:45

小议基于嵌入式Linux操作系统的AODV路由协议1.引言无线 Ad Hoc 网,又称移动多跳无线网、移动分组无线网、无线自组网等,是一种无中心、不需要固定基础设施支持的无线网络。它是由一组带有无线收发装置的移动终端组成的一个多跳无线网络,不依赖于固定基础设施,网络中的移动终端通过自身的无线收发设备来收发信息。当通信终端不在彼此通信范围时,可以借助其它的中间终端节点进行数据转发,从而构成多跳网络。...

c语言编程acm链表的逆置

2023-12-28 21:07:52

标题:C语言编程ACM:链表的逆置一、概述ACM(Advanced Computing Machinery)竞赛是计算机科学领域最负盛名的竞赛之一,要在ACM竞赛中获得优异的成绩,熟练掌握C语言编程技术是必不可少的。本文将讨论C语言编程中常见的ACM题目之一:链表的逆置。二、链表的基本概念1.链表的定义链表是一种线性表的物理存储单位,由一个个节点组成,每个节点包含数据元素和下一个节点的指针。链表中...

ROS2入门教程—理解参数(Parameter)

2023-12-28 18:45:24

ROS2⼊门教程—理解参数(Parameter)ROS2⼊门教程—理解参数(Parameter)param name  参数也是ROS2中很重要的⼀个概念,主要作⽤是对节点功能的配置,在ROS2中,每个节点都有⾃⼰的参数,这些参数可以⽤整型数、浮点数、布尔型数、字符串和列表来描述。所有参数都是动态可重新配置的,并基于ROS 2服务构建。1 启动⼩海龟仿真器  打开新终端并运⾏:...

ROS向节点传递参数的几种方式

2023-12-28 18:38:15

ROS向节点传递参数的⼏种⽅式ROS的节点有很多中调⽤⽅式,包括rosrun,launch,直接运⾏等,向节点内传递参数的⽅式也有很多。1. rosrun + 参数服务器传递param nameros::init(argc, argv, "imu2txt");ros::NodeHandle nh("~");std::string file_name;nh.param<std::string&...

机器人导航(仿真)(二)——amcl定位

2023-12-28 18:31:13

机器⼈导航(仿真)(⼆)——amcl定位导航实现02_amcl定位参考视频:所谓定位就是推算机器⼈⾃⾝在全局地图中的位置,当然,SLAM中也包含定位算法实现,不过SLAM的定位是⽤于构建全局地图的,是属于导航开始之前的阶段,⽽当前定位是⽤于导航中,导航中,机器⼈需要按照设定的路线运动,通过定位可以判断机器⼈的实际轨迹是否符合预期。在ROS的导航功能包集navigation中提供了 amcl 功能包...

C#winform权限管理系统完整源码下载(含数据库)

2023-12-28 18:29:23

C#winform权限管理系统完整源码下载(含数据库)【实例截图】⽂件:(访问密码:551685)【核⼼代码】using System;using System.Collections.Generic;using System.ComponentModel;using System.Data;using System.Drawing;using System.Text;using System.W...

treeList复选框的使用

2023-12-28 18:11:34

/// <summary>/// 点击节点前,可以不使用/// </summary>/// <param name="sender"></param>/// <param name="e"></param>private void treeList1_BeforeCheckNode(object sender, DevExpr...

ROS与Python中如何使用参数

2023-12-28 18:08:20

ROS与Python中如何使⽤参数在这⾥我将简单介绍参数的获取,参数的设置,参数的修改和参数的查询1.参数的获取使⽤_param(‘param_name‘)获取全局参数_param(‘/global_param_name')获取⽬前命名空间的参数_param('param_name')获取私有命名空间的参数_param('~p...

launc件中param、rosparam以及arg之间的区别

2023-12-28 18:08:08

launch⽂件中param、rosparam以及arg之间的区别param、rosparam以及arg都是对launch⽂件中的参数进⾏设置,下⾯说说它们三个之间的区别param与rosparam两个参数调⽤差不多,都是把launch⽂件中的⼀些参数直接设置到rosmaster(ros中的节点管理器)⾥⾯以便于各个节点的使⽤,主要不同在于param只对⼀个参数进⾏操作,使⽤⽅式如下:<pa...

ROS常用命令汇总

2023-12-28 18:06:34

ROS常用命令汇总以下是一些常用的ROS命令汇总:1. roscore:启动ROS的核心服务器。2. rosrun:用于运行一个ROS节点的命令。3. roslaunch:用于启动一个包含多个节点的ROS系统。4. rosnode list:列出当前运行的所有ROS节点。5. rosnode info [node_name]:显示特定节点的信息,包括节点的发布和订阅的话题列表。6. rostopi...

Unity通过递归查子节点物体和对应组件

2023-12-28 18:03:55

Unity通过递归查⼦节点物体和对应组件递归查是我们在⽇常开发中很容易⽤到的⼀种查⽅法,通常我们在开发中都直接将其封装为⼀个查⼯具类,便于我们全局使⽤。接下来我就为⼤家详解⼀下递归查⼦节点物体和对应组件的⼯具类:using System.Collections;using System.Collections.Generic;using UnityEngine;public class...

C#类对象数据存储(Object自定义序列化)

2023-12-28 17:59:41

C#类对象数据存储(Object⾃定义序列化)获取Object对象的所有成员变量:FieldInfo[] fields = obj.GetType().GetFields();    // obj可以为任意类型对象获取变量名称:string name = field.Name;获取变量值:Object valueObj = field.GetValue(obj);设置obj中指...

C#类库DLL配置文件

2023-12-28 17:42:55

C#类库DLL配置⽂件C#类库DLL配置⽂件在.NET⾥⾯,类库项⽬是没有相应的配置⽂件的,但有时候写⼀些公共的类库DLL,⼜希望有配置⽂件来进⾏配置,以适应需求变化。还是⽼话,微软既然不提供,咱⾃⼰来写个吧。在类库项⽬中创建ConfigurationManager类.使⽤.NET framework 4.0,在web,windows,window service 中均进⾏过测试。使⽤时需将配置⽂...

Swarm容器集管理(超详细)

2023-12-28 17:33:15

Swarm容器集管理(超详细)⼀、Swarm介绍Swarm是Docker公司⾃研发的容器集管理系统, Swarm在早期是作为⼀个独⽴服务存在,在Docker Engine v1.12中集成了Swarm的集管理和编排功能。可以通过初始化Swarm或加⼊现有Swarm来启⽤Docker引擎的Swarm模式。Docker Engine CLI和API包括了管理Swarm节点命令,⽐如添加、删除节点...

DockerSwarm简单教程

2023-12-28 17:17:41

DockerSwarm简单教程⽂章⽬录⼀、什么是Docker Swarm  换⾔之,各种形式的Docker Client(compose,docker-py等)均可以直接与Swarm通信,甚⾄Docker本⾝都可以很容易的与Swarm 集成,这⼤⼤⽅便了⽤户将原本基于单节点的系统移植到Swarm上,同时Swarm内置了对Docker⽹络插件的⽀持,⽤户也很容易的部署跨主机的容器集服务。...

docker-swarm的运用

2023-12-28 16:55:07

docker-swarm的运⽤写了如何使⽤docker-compose来部署服务。虽然docker-compose解决了docker间通信问题,但是缺点也是很明显的。就是只能在⼀台宿主机上通信。我们使⽤docker-compose在宿主机上部署了20+的应⽤,宿主机配置 16C 32GB RAM。服务全部启动后,常态内存占⽤就⾼达85%。显然是⽆法应对突发情况的,因此如果服务⽐较多,仅仅使⽤doc...

Docker Swarm集的节点管理与故障恢复

2023-12-28 16:48:16

Docker Swarm集的节点管理与故障恢复随着云计算和容器化技术的快速发展,Docker Swarm作为一个集管理工具,已经成为了许多企业和开发者的首选。它可以帮助用户快速、高效地部署和管理容器化应用,提高了应用的可伸缩性和容错性。在这篇文章中,我们将探讨Docker Swarm集的节点管理与故障恢复这一重要议题。一、节点管理Docker Swarm允许用户将多个主机(节点)组合成一个虚...

利用Docker Compose进行多节点服务协同开发

2023-12-28 16:46:11

利用Docker Compose进行多节点服务协同开发随着云计算和容器化技术的不断发展,多节点服务协同开发变得越来越普遍。在传统的开发环境中,每个开发者都需要在自己的本地机器上部署服务和环境,这样会带来一系列的问题,比如环境不一致、部署复杂等。而利用Docker Compose,我们可以轻松地实现多节点服务协同开发,提高开发效率和代码质量。一、Docker Compose简介Docker Comp...

如何在Docker Swarm中实现故障转移

2023-12-28 16:35:44

如何在Docker Swarm中实现故障转移Docker Swarm是一个用于运行容器化应用程序的工具,它可以将多个Docker主机组织成一个虚拟的Swarm,使得应用程序可以在多个主机上同时运行,从而实现高可用性和负载均衡。然而,在一个分布式的应用程序中,故障转移是必不可少的。本文将介绍如何在Docker Swarm中实现故障转移。1. 使用Docker Swarm的故障转移功能Docker S...

k8s常见异常事件及解决方案

2023-12-28 16:23:10

k8s常见异常事件及解决⽅案⽂章⽬录1.集相关1.1 Coredns容器或local-dns容器重启集中的coredns组件发⽣重启(重新创建),⼀般是由于coredns组件压⼒较⼤导致oom,请检查业务是否异常,是否存在应⽤容器⽆法解析域名的异常。如果是local-dns重启,说明local-dns的性能也不够了,需要优化1.2 Pod was OOM killed云应⽤容器实例发⽣OOM,...

docker部署redis集

2023-12-28 15:32:33

docker部署redis集⼀、查询最新redis镜像docker search redis⼆、下载redis镜像docker pull redis三、创建⼀个⽂件夹,以及创建pl模板⽂件mkdir redis-cluster-dcd redis-cluster-dport ${PORT}masterauth 123456requirepass 123456clu...

Docker下使用搭建RedisCluster集方案

2023-12-28 15:12:45

Docker下使⽤搭建RedisCluster集⽅案RedisCluster集⽅案是Redis官⽅推荐的⼀种集⽅案,他没有中⼼节点。客户端与redis节点直连,不需要中间代理层,RedisCluster 集⽅案可以将数据分⽚存储。为避免其中⼀个节点宕机丢失分⽚数据,我们需要设置冗余节点。设计架构:准备前提:1、Linux服务器(这⾥使⽤的centos7.x演⽰)2、已安...

ELKdockerelasticsearch7设置xpack账号密码

2023-12-28 15:10:05

ELKdockerelasticsearch7设置xpack账号密码之前写过⼀篇设置的,感觉不⼤对。还是重新配置⼀下。准备资料:elasticsearch7.1.1、kibana7.1.1镜像⽂件。在docker下成功安装集。注意的是,所有的需要安装es相关的ELK版本都要⼀致,甚⾄es的插件版本也都是要⼀致[root@localhost ~]# docker imagesREPOSITORY&...

sing-box搭建节点

2023-12-28 15:09:42

sing-box搭建节点SingularityNET是一个基于区块链的人工智能服务市场,而Sing-Box则是一种搭建SingularityNET节点的方法。下面将详细介绍如何使用Sing-Box搭建SingularityNET节点。首先,需要在操作系统中安装Docker和Docker Compose。Docker是一种容器化技术,可以帮助我们创建独立的环境,而Docker Compose则可以协...

华为云-容器引擎CCE-基本概念

2023-12-28 15:05:59

华为云-容器引擎CCE-基本概念云容器引擎(Cloud Container Engine,简称CCE)提供⾼度可扩展的、⾼性能的企业级Kubernetes集,⽀持运⾏Docker容器。借助云容器引擎,您可以在华为云上轻松部署、管理和扩展容器化应⽤程序。云容器引擎提供Kubernetes原⽣API,⽀持使⽤kubectl,且提供图形化控制台,让您能够拥有完整的端到端使⽤体验,使⽤云容器引擎前,建议...

在Docker Swarm中实现容器迁移与故障转移

2023-12-28 14:49:18

在Docker Swarm中实现容器迁移与故障转移docker进入容器Docker Swarm是一种用于容器编排和管理的工具,它能够帮助用户在分布式环境中管理大规模的Docker容器集。在Docker Swarm中,容器迁移和故障转移是非常重要的功能,它们可以保证容器运行的高可用性和可靠性。一、容器迁移的需求和挑战在实际的应用场景中,我们经常会遇到需要迁移容器的情况。比如,当某个节点的负载过高或...

《Docker技术集与应用》课程测试试卷-2

2023-12-28 14:27:28

《Docker技术集与应用》课程测试试卷-2《Docker技术集与应用》课程测试试卷说明:本试卷由选择题和简答题两部分组成,满分100分。一、选择题说明:共30题,每题2分,共计60分。针对以下题目,请选择最符合题目要求的答案。针对每一道题目,所有答案都选对,则该题得分,所选答案错误或不能选出所有答案,则该题不得分。1.下列关于Docker核心概念的说法错误的是()。A.Docker镜像是创建...

jenkins配合dockerfile部署项目

2023-12-28 14:03:31

jenkins配合dockerfile部署项⽬前⾔本节需要对jenkinsfile有点了解,对dockerfile有点了解,对shell有点了解,对docker有点了解执⾏流程docker打包镜像1. jenkins拉取代码仓库中的代码2. jenkins执⾏jenkinsfile⽂件(可指定⽂件名)3. 先在jenkins所在的服务器将拉取的项⽬build成docker镜像4. 将镜像发布到镜像...

在Docker容器中构建和调试多节点集的方法

2023-12-28 13:23:10

在Docker容器中构建和调试多节点集的方法引言:随着云计算和虚拟化技术的快速发展,容器化技术也逐渐成为了软件开发和部署的主流方式之一。Docker作为当前最流行的容器技术之一,为开发人员提供了一种轻量级的、可移植和可扩展的部署解决方案。本文将介绍如何在Docker容器中构建和调试多节点集的方法,以实现更高效的软件开发和测试。一. Docker容器基础知识在使用Docker构建和调试多节点集...

如何使用Docker技术进行多节点集部署

2023-12-28 13:12:17

如何使用Docker技术进行多节点集部署近年来,Docker技术因其轻量、快速、可移植的特性受到广泛关注和应用。作为一种容器化技术,Docker可以帮助开发人员在不同的平台上轻松构建、打包和部署应用程序。在大规模系统中,使用Docker能够提供更好的容错能力和可伸缩性,尤其在多节点集部署方面更是如此。在本文中,将重点介绍如何使用Docker技术进行多节点集部署。多节点集部署有助于提高系统的...

最新文章